Exterior of pool at the Hard Rock Hotel in Vegas.Quite possibly one of the hottest hotels in Vegas, the Hard Rock Hotel has something for everybody when it comes to music.

From lighting fixtures made from cymbals to door handles shaped as Fender guitars, there are reminders of what rock is all about. The entire hotel serves as a museum dedicated to rock legends.

Motorcycles that one belonged to rockers Nikki Sixx and Matt Sorum guard the entry way to the casino while autographed guitars, costumes and articles of clothing from artists such as Madonna, Aerosmith, U2 and the Ramones are all encased in glass for your viewing pleasure.

This hotel isn't just all about sightseeing and memorabilia, though. The Center Bar is a haven for the beautiful, so if you think you qualify then belly on up to the bar. Body English is the hotel's nightclub and gives the chance to dance the night away. If all the rock mementos have you jonesing to check out a live act then head on over to The Joint where you can check out acts such as Ozzy Osbourne, The Rolling Stones, Green Day and Sting.

No hotel would be complete without gourmet dinning and the Hard Rock has got you covered. You can take your pick from dinning at the posh and elegant Simon Kitchen & Bar, to the get it and go taste of Mr. Lucky's 24/7 and The Pink Taco, or you can sit down and get a taste of classic Vegas as you dine at AJ's Steakhouse.
